Under Level 5 restrictions, which were implemented this week, farmers have not been allowed to attend livestock marts.  An online bidding system was set up for those who want to sell livestock, but the system has been branded a ‘disaster’ For more on this we heard from Deputy Mattie McGrath, Leader of the Rural Independent Group.
